Arlington Community Schools Position Description AHS School Nutrition Tech 5.5 Reports to: School Nutrition Manager and Building Principal Goal: To assist the School Nutrition Manager in the efficient operation of the cafeteria by preparing and serving nutritious and attractive meals for students and staff in a pleasant environment while maintaining a clean and sanitary work area. Minimum Qualifications High School Diploma Ability to work in areas which are often uncomfortable, wet, and slippery. Ability to work in the temperatures found in hot kitchens and the walk-in refrigerators and freezers. Ability to understand and adhere to safety procedures and take precautions required to avoid cuts, bruises, burns, scalds, and falls. Ability to understand and follow directions in English, both oral and written, to ensure safety of food preparation and service. Ability to read, write, and perform basic mathematical calculations. Ability to keep accurate records. Experience in commercial food service preferred. Ability to communicate effectively and collaborate with colleagues. Ability to follow standardized recipes. Ability to lift a minimum of 50 pounds. Job Responsibilities Performs required duties involved in the preparation of food items for students and staff meals to include: checking menu and following work schedules; reading and following recipes and/or instructions for preparing pre-portioned items; assembling ingredients and utensils; cooking; serving; and clean up. Also includes bag lunches and preparing snacks for school programs as required. Appears clean, neat, and wears proper attire. Follows written instructions as they apply to recipes and production records. Maintains composure and projects a pleasant personality with fellow workers, faculty, and students. Monitors and records cooking times and temperatures to ensure thorough heating as required for consumer safety under HACCP regulations. Sets up serving lines and maintains cleanliness of serving area; ensure the availability of necessary serving utensils; serve food in the appropriate quantity per customer. Maintains cleanliness and sanitization of equipment, food preparation and serving areas, and storage areas, and safely handles and stores utensils, pans, serving ware and cookware. Assists in stocking supplies and monitors inventory, rotates food products as scheduled. May serve as cashier, operating a point-of-sale terminal and collecting monies. Performs all duties in compliance with school, District and Health Department policies, procedures, and standards of quality and care. Prepares accurate work records as required; may enter and retrieve computer data as needed. Attends training and meetings as necessary to maintain and enhance job knowledge and skills.
